Visual Novel Coffee Talk To Receive Collector's Editions Later This Year

Colorado-based publisherSerenity Forgehas revealed it will bedistributing physical and collector’s editionsof the barista simulator visual novelCoffee Talkand its upcoming sequel, Coffee Talk Episode 2: Hibiscus & Butterfly. A total of four different physical editions will be available for the Nintendo Switch, PlayStation 4, and PlayStation 5 versions of the Coffee Talk duet, with each of them expected to ship before August 2023. Developed byToge Productionsand published by Chorus Worldwide, Coffee Talk is currently available as a digital download on all current-gen consoles, and on PC via Steam, GOG, and the Epic Games Store....

Windbound Revealed by 5 Lives Studios with an August Release Date

In an April 2 PlayStation Blog co-founder of 5 Lives Studios, Mitch Clifford revealedWindbound, the studio’s second project. 5 Lives' last game wasSatellite Reign; a cyberpunk top-down strategy game that released in August 2015. 5 Lives appear to have gone in a completely different direction withWindboundas screenshots show a colorful island-riddled ocean in an art-style similar toRimeandWind Waker. Clifford shared some insight into the game’s story and setting; “Windbound takes place on a long-forgotten archipelago, once home to an ancient civilization....
